Best boba!
I love this boba! Super easy to make and tastes just like the popular boba shops.In regards to all the reviews saying they don't taste right/sweet/etc... that's because they aren't being prepared correctly. You have to let the boba sit in brown sugar after cooking for a bit. I usually leave mine for at least an hour.My whole process:โขBoil water (you don't need quite as much as the directions say) .โขadd boba and stir, return to boilโขlet boil for 5 minutes or a bit more if you like them super soft.โขdrain and dunk in cold water for 20 seconds (or just rinse under faucet for that long.โขstrain and put into a container of brown sugar. Stir. The liquid from the boba will dissolve the sugar and you'll have a syrup in just a few moments.โขlet sit for half hour to an hour at least before adding to drink of choice.โขcan store in the syrup for a day, just microwave in 30 second intervals until chewy again. Being careful not to overheat or they will become very hard.
